Why is my Alexa Echo Dot not responding?

Often, an unresponsive Echo can be the result of a faulty Wi-Fi connection. To start, try performing a hard reset of all your network hardware; starting with your Echo Dot, then your router, then your modem. Wait a solid 10-15 seconds for each component, then re-power everything in reverse.

What are the 4 buttons on Alexa?

Hello, Gail! The top of the Echo Dot has 4 buttons. The – and + are the volume controls, the circle is the action button, and the circle with the line through it is the microphone off button. When you press the action button, you can ask Alexa questions or to control things.

What does the circle with a line through it mean on Alexa?

White circle with a line through it means Alexa is in privacy mode. Press the button on the top with the same icon and with will take Alexa out of privacy.

Why is the light on my Alexa spinning?

When you adjust device volume, white lights show the volume levels. A spinning white light means Alexa Guard is turned on and in Away mode. Return Alexa to Home mode in the Alexa app.

Can Alexa call 911?

You can’t ask Alexa to dial 911 or other emergency services directly, unless you have an Echo Connect hooked up to a landline phone. You can, however, set up a personal emergency contact, and turn on Alexa Guard for home security.

Why does Alexa blink green?

A spinning or flashing green light on your Echo device means there’s an incoming call or an active call or an active Drop In.

How do I stop the spinning green light on my Alexa?

To stop the flashing green light, pick up the call (by saying “answer call”), decline the call (by saying “decline call”), or simply ignore the call until it stops ringing.

Why is my Alexa blue and spinning?

Blue and cyan mean Alexa is working for you If you speak the wake word or manually wake Alexa, the light ring will turn solid blue, and a small section of cyan will point in the direction of the person speaking. Solid blue with spinning cyan after you’ve spoken a command means Alexa is processing your request.
